What is so bad about 3pt backhoes? Is a sub mount better and why? Thanks
 
   / 3pt vs sub mount backhoes #2  
Probably the big thing is the forces generated by the backhoe that are significantly different from a towed implement. The sub-frame attachment points keep them away from the rear axle housing/3 pt hitch componets & ties the front & rear of the tractor together to reduce torsion between the two. I'm no subject area expert, but this is the gist of what I've read when reviewing the subject in the past. My 3038e has an aluminum rear axle housing. I wouldn't take a chance & use a 3 pt. BH there, but would instead use the Wood's sub-frame/BH combo if I really had to put a backhoe on it.

if you get a 3pt hoe.. deffinately try to fab up some kind of extra bracing for it.

I have a woods 6500 on an old 1955 ford 850. I made up a sub frame that grabbed bolts on axle trumpets used for fenders and rops.. also some ont he center housing for the trumpet to center, plus more from top cover to center. I also made a cage/brace bracket for the toplink, to keep the top connection from jerking the tractors draft sensing toplink all over the place.

She digs good.. and as someone else said. the tail can easilly wag the dog if the hoe is made to really dig.
